Disinformation Fuels Anxiety as ICE Arrests Continue Under New Administration

Rumors and false reports regarding immigration enforcement have proliferated in recent weeks, causing significant distress and confusion within immigrant communities. These misleading narratives often center around claims of widespread raids and indiscriminate arrests, painting a picture of aggressive enforcement actions that don’t align with current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) practices. This misinformation, amplified through social media and word-of-mouth, has created an atmosphere of fear and uncertainty, impacting families and communities across the nation. The spread of these inaccurate portrayals underscores the importance of verifying information from credible sources and exercising caution when encountering unconfirmed reports online.

While the new administration has signaled a shift in immigration policy, emphasizing a focus on humane and targeted enforcement, ICE continues to conduct arrests. The agency maintains that its operations prioritize individuals posing a threat to public safety, national security, and border security. This includes individuals with criminal convictions, those who have re-entered the country illegally after prior deportation, and those who have recently crossed the border without authorization. The continuation of these targeted enforcement actions has been misinterpreted by some as a sign that the administration’s policy changes are merely cosmetic, further fueling the anxieties stoked by disinformation campaigns.

One Minnesota resident recently shared his experience with ICE, providing a firsthand account of the agency’s ongoing activities. While details remain limited to protect the individual’s privacy, the account highlights the real-world impact of ongoing enforcement actions. This individual’s story serves as a reminder of the human element within the complex and often contentious immigration debate, emphasizing the importance of understanding the individual circumstances and experiences behind the headlines.

The spread of disinformation surrounding ICE activities underscores the vulnerability of immigrant communities to fear-mongering and manipulation. This misinformation can have tangible consequences, leading individuals to avoid seeking essential services, cooperating with law enforcement, or even reporting crimes. The resulting climate of fear can erode trust in authorities and create further barriers between immigrant communities and the broader society. Combating disinformation requires a multi-pronged approach, including promoting media literacy, fact-checking information from unreliable sources, and amplifying accurate information from trusted sources like government agencies and reputable news outlets.

The Biden administration has outlined several key changes to immigration policy, including a focus on addressing the root causes of migration, streamlining the asylum process, and creating pathways to citizenship for undocumented individuals. However, these policy changes are complex and require time to implement fully. The continued enforcement actions by ICE during this transitional period have contributed to confusion and skepticism among some, who question the extent and sincerity of the administration’s commitment to reform. Clear and consistent communication from the government regarding its enforcement priorities and ongoing policy changes is crucial to addressing the anxieties and misconceptions fueled by disinformation campaigns.
